    Eat three meals regularly.

    Many diabetics believe that eating less staple foods can prevent blood sugar from rising. However, this is not only prone to hypoglycemia, but also promotes excessive breakdown of body fat and protein, causing weight loss, malnutrition, and even starvation ketosis. Therefore, it is important to eat three good meals regularly.

    One is exercise, proper exercise! Walk at a moderate pace for more than 40 minutes a day to burn fat and promote insulin secretion.

    The second is diet, control the diet! Each meal must control the staple food within 2 taels of grains, and eat more vegetables; High blood sugar is a disease caused by eating! Don't eat more!!

    The third is drug control, don't shy away from medical treatment! Get in touch with your specialist for guidance.

    The fourth is to measure, regularly self-test blood sugar, 4-5 times a day, 4 days a month, and control it in a targeted manner.

    The main thing is to pay attention. strategically despise the enemy and tactically value the enemy; We must not only pay attention to the reality of getting sick, but not be afraid; It is also necessary to actively cooperate with the doctors** and prepare for long-term combat.
